A36 hot rolled steel c channels, also referred to as “American Standard Channels”, are an excellent candidate for most processing techniques. A36 hot rolled steel channels have a rough, blue-grey finish. A36 material is a low carbon steel mild steel which is long lasting and durable. Hot rolled C channels have a “structural shape” meaning at least one dimension (excluding length) is greater than 3 inches. C channels inside flange surface have approximately a 16-2/3% slope, which distinguishes them from “MC” channels. Common applications include structural support, trailers, and other architectural uses. ASTM A36 / A36M-08 is the standard specification for carbon structural steel.

ASTM A36 steel channel is hot-rolled, low carbon steel section with good properties including welding, machinability and ductility. A36 structural channel have two types of sizes: UPN & UPE - tapered flanges and parallel flanges respectively. Technical data
A36 steel channel chemical composition
Steel grade Styles Carbon, max, % Manganese, % Phosphorus, max, % Sulfur, max, % Silicon, %
A36 Steel shapes 0.26 -- 0.04 0.05 ≤0.40

NOTE: Copper content is available when your order is specified.

A36 steel channel mechanical property
Steel grade Styles Tensile strength, ksi [MPa] Yield point, min, ksi [MPa] Elongation in 8 in. [200 mm], min, % Elongation in 2 in. [50 mm], min, %
A36 Steel shapes 58 - 80 [400 - 550] 36 [250] 20 21
